Originally Posted by SwissCircle

My thoughts exactly. Yet I’m tempted, el cheapo Eco travel is what it is and that status would certainly help easing it
It's completely off what DL see's it's brand as. They aren't necessarily above selling status's but they certainly aren't going to allow it to happen on Ebay.

My money is on them photoshopping some AA EP/CK or UA 1K/GS account with your name instead. It wouldn't even have to be that high of quality if they fax it into DL. And unless they are sending in hundreds it would be unlikely to be discovered quickly. In the mean time they pocket some easy money for 15 minutes worth of photoshop work.

When/if DL finds out about this, at minimum those status are going bye bye, and at worst, they completely close the Skymiles accounts and you're left with no miles even if you had a bunch before hand.
